Story 1: A mechanic was replacing L44643L bearings in an industrial motor. After installing the new bearings, he realized he had forgotten to lubricate them. The motor started running, and within minutes, the bearings seized up, causing the motor to overheat and fail.
Lesson: Always follow proper maintenance procedures and never neglect lubrication.
Story 2: A farmer was using an L44643L bearing in his tractor's water pump. One day, the pump started making a squealing noise. The farmer inspected the bearing and found that it had become rusty due to water contamination.
Lesson: Protect bearings from contamination and ensure proper sealing in harsh operating environments.
Story 3: A construction worker was operating a jackhammer with L44643L bearings. The jackhammer suddenly stopped working, and the worker discovered that the bearings had shattered due to excessive load and vibration.
Lesson: Consider the load capacity and operating conditions when selecting bearings, and avoid overloading or subjecting them to extreme conditions.

Q1: What is the difference between L44643L and L44643LU bearings?
A: The L44643LU bearing is a variant of the L44643L bearing with a rubber seal on one side. The seal protects the bearing from dirt and moisture, making it suitable for applications in harsh environments.
Q2: Can I use any grease to lubricate L44643L bearings?
A: No, it is recommended to use a high-quality grease specifically designed for bearing lubrication. Lithium-based greases are commonly used for L44643L bearings.
Q3: How often should I replace L44643L bearings?
A: The replacement frequency depends on the operating conditions and maintenance practices. Regular monitoring and proper lubrication can extend the lifespan of bearings significantly.
Q4: What is the maximum operating temperature for L44643L bearings?
A: The maximum operating temperature for L44643L bearings is typically around 120°C (248°F).
Q5: Can I use L44643L bearings in high-speed applications?
A: Yes, L44643L bearings can be used in high-speed applications, but it is important to consider the speed rating and consult with the manufacturer for specific recommendations.
Q6: How do I calculate the lifespan of L44643L bearings?
A: The lifespan of L44643L bearings can be estimated using the L10 life equation. The L10 life represents the number of operating hours at a given load and speed before 10% of the bearings will fail.
